Decorative Title Page to the [1874] William Nicholson & Sons, S.D. Ewins & Co. Reprint
This is the decorative title page to the [1874] William Nicholson & Sons, S.D. Ewins & Co. Reprint. The title is printed in the page's top quarter followed by a period. The author's pseudonym, Elizabeth Wetherell, appears below a decorative rule. An decorative image of a rose branch appears in the page's middle. William Nicholson & Sons' address is listed as, "Wakefield." Above a decorative rule, S.D. Ewins & Co.'s address is listed as, "London, Paternoster Row."

Frontispiece to the [1874] William Nicholson & Sons, S.D. Ewins & Co. Reprint Depicting Ellen Arriving at Alice's While She is Making Cakes
This is the frontispiece to the [1874] William Nicholson & Sons, S.D. Ewins & Co. Reprint, depicting Ellen arriving at Alice's while she is making cakes. This colorful image depicts a scene from page 72, of Alice, Ellen and Margery, together in the kitchen. Alice is making cakes when Ellen arrives, while Margery sits over by the fire, behind the table. Alice holds a lantern over her head, looking down at Ellen, holding a plate of cakes. Ellen is dressed in her outer wear of the time period.

Decorative Title Page of the [1922] T. Nelson & Sons "The Nelson Classics" Reprint
In the title page for T. Nelson & Sons' 1912 edition of the novel, the text is enclosed within a decorative border resembling floral vines. The title is printed in the top quarter of the page without a period. The author's name is printed under the pseudonym Elizabeth Wetherell. A red stamp indicates the book was collected on the 17th of October in 1912 by the Advocates Library in Edinburgh. The address of the publisher is not listed.
